Handicap Ramp Repair in Wilmington, NC
Handicap ramp repair services focus on restoring safety and accessibility to existing wheelchair ramps and mobility aids around residential properties. This includes fixing structural issues such as loose or damaged handrails, cracked or wobbling surfaces, and deteriorated supports that may compromise stability. Projects typically involve assessing the current ramp condition, replacing worn-out components, and ensuring the ramp meets safety standards for ease of use. Property owners often seek these repairs to maintain compliance with accessibility needs or to prevent potential hazards that could cause injury or limit mobility.
Before requesting handicap ramp repairs, property owners usually want to understand the scope of work needed to improve safety and functionality. It’s helpful to consider the age and condition of the existing ramp, any specific safety concerns, and whether modifications are necessary to meet current accessibility guidelines. Clear communication about the type of damage or wear observed can assist in determining whether repairs are sufficient or if a full replacement might be advisable. Proper assessment ensures that the repaired ramp will provide reliable access for those who depend on it.

Handicap Ramp Repair Questions
What types of handicap ramp repairs are commonly requested? Repairs often include fixing loose handrails, addressing surface damage, and restoring stability of the ramp structure.
How can I tell if a handicap ramp needs repair? Signs include wobbling, cracks, missing parts, or difficulty in safely supporting mobility devices.
Are repairs available for different ramp materials? Yes, repairs can be performed on wood, aluminum, and concrete ramps to restore safety and functionality.
